SE bootloader unlocking refers to the process of unlocking the bootloader on devices with a Secure Engine (SE) chip, which is a security feature designed to protect the device from unauthorized access. Unlocking the bootloader allows you to make changes to the device's software, such as installing custom ROMs, kernels, and recoveries.
